Meaning of Oni
Today; Demon; Born on a holy ground; Shelter
Oni is a unisex name with diverse origins and meanings. In Yoruba, a Western African language, Oni means ‘today’ and can be given to a male baby who cries excessively as a traditional circumstance name. In Japanese, the name is derived from the word ‘oni,’ which means ‘demon.’ In Sanskrit, Oni means ‘heaven and earth, two protectors.’ In Native American origin, it is primarily a female name that means ‘born on the holy ground.’ Additionally, the African origins of Oni can be traced back to both Benin and Yoruba cultures, where it means ‘shelter or one born in a sacred place.’
